### Item 14: Cross-service trace verification

Before sign-off, confirm request tracing propagates across all Lanternwick microservices. Run the synthetic checkout flow, verify spans appear in the Fernline dashboard for gateway, pricing, and ledger services. No orphaned spans permitted. If any service drops trace headers, block the release and page the owning team. Attach the trace exporter version to the release notes. The trace token used for the verification run is recorded below.

pipeline stamp: htk9_ce63042d9

## Crashfeed Plugin Onboarding

Plugins receive crash batches from the Crashfeed relay. Symbolication happens upstream; you get normalized frames only. Register your plugin manifest, declare the event types you consume, and respect the 30s processing budget — slow plugins get detached. Local testing uses the replay harness with canned reports from the Marblehead test fleet. Create a `.env` in your plugin root with your relay endpoint settings. Your ingest credential goes on the line directly below this comment.

vault entry, bafof-tagug: ARCHIVE_KEY3=4d8

This page summarizes the margin review completed by the Harwick finance group. Blended gross margin slipped 1.8 points, driven mainly by freight surcharges on the Lunora line and discounting in the western region. Product mix was otherwise stable. Corrective actions: renegotiated carrier rates, a discount-approval threshold at director level, and quarterly SKU-level tracking. Finance team members should update their forecast templates accordingly before the next close. Context on forward plans appears below.

confidential, kagup-bafog: Fraaxax Group is in early talks to buy Soroxox Group for about $343.8 million. The Olidor launch date is June 14, and nothing goes to the press before then. Legal wants the Aldmirek Logistics term sheet signed before July 23.

**Handover Note — Lease Renegotiation, Dunmere Works**

From outgoing Director Halloway to Director Prentice. Negotiations with the landlord of the Carraway Street site have reached a third draft. Key open points: the break clause at year five and responsibility for roof repairs. All correspondence is filed chronologically. The strategic context for our position is summarised directly beneath.

board note of kagep-yahig: Only 9 of the 120 pilot accounts renewed Quenix, so a churn review is set for April 1.